Historic River Cottage in the heart of Old Town Bluffton
Built in 1909 the Historic Fripp-Lowden is the most photographed house in Bluffton. The back yard backs up to a beautiful creek with river views. 150 year old live oak trees with Spanish moss provide a magical setting for honey moons or time of rest. No cost spared in the 2022 cottage renovation. One block walk to the May River park where the view was named by Southern Living Magazine as the prettiest sunset view in South Carolina. Rent a kayak, fish from the public dock, or picnic just steps from the front and back yards.
